Within the days main as much as the Arizona Republican major for governor, candidate Kari Lake warned that one thing was going very unsuitable. “We’re already detecting some stealing happening,” Lake mentioned at a marketing campaign cease the week earlier than the election. Hours earlier than the polls closed, she hadn’t modified her tune. “If we don’t win, there’s some dishonest happening. And we already know that.” However when the race was over, Lake was the brand new Republican nominee for governor in Arizona. This created a little bit of a logical pickle for Lake: How did she win an election that was rigged?

“We out-voted the fraud,” Lake mentioned at a press convention the following day, including that her marketing campaign had proof of fraud that she wouldn’t element with the media, however would give to “the authorities.” 

Lake is just not the one candidate this major season who has had to determine learn how to — or whether or not to — unring fraud’s bell. Some candidates have stayed within the secure area of simply saying 2020 was rigged. Others have claimed their very own race as suspect. Both means, the dangers are clear: Each time a candidate says the system is rigged, their supporters usually tend to change into satisfied the system is rigged. And victory doesn’t all the time finish the candidate’s claims: Many preserve at it, win or lose.

“It’s not solely smaller races the place it’s occurring. It’s occurring in races of all sizes,” mentioned Wendy Weiser, the vice chairman for democracy on the Brennan Middle for Justice, a nonpartisan regulation and public coverage institute. “A part of what’s regarding about it’s how widespread this tactic has change into.”

By my depend, a minimum of a dozen major candidates have misplaced their election after which instantly cried fraud. Tina Peters, who ran within the GOP major for secretary of state in Colorado (and has an extended historical past with election denialism), blamed fraud after her third-place end, saying, “We didn’t lose. We simply came upon extra fraud.” Two candidates for the Republican primaries for Senate and governor in Michigan made comparable claims after dropping by broad margins. Joey Gilbert, a candidate for the Republican governor’s race in Nevada, referred to as for a recount after dropping the race to Clark County Sheriff Joe Lombardo by about 26,000 votes, citing “disingenuous exercise” and claiming that he, in reality, gained.

In Georgia, Republican candidate for governor Kandiss Taylor ended up dropping the first by 70 factors, coming in third with lower than 4 p.c of the vote behind incumbent Gov. Brian Kemp and Trump-endorsed former Sen. David Perdue. But Taylor has refused to concede. She is suspicious of the election machines utilized in Georgia (each poll marking units and tabulators), says the election was “rigged” towards her and has demanded a hand recount of the entire ballots. However she additionally advised FiveThirtyEight that she doesn’t know if a recount would change the outcomes.

“I do not know. We don’t know,” she mentioned. “It’s probably not, for me, about turning over the election. It’s extra in regards to the machines going away and us having checks and balances.” 

An identical sentiment has been shared by a slate of GOP major election losers in Kentucky, six of whom have pursued recounts even when dropping by giant margins. The candidates haven’t made express claims of fraud and as a substitute say their objective is just to “verify the tech” and confirm the outcomes. However Michael Adams, Kentucky’s secretary of state and a Republican, mentioned that rationalization is only a cowl.

“They’re not telling the reality. They love shifting the goalposts,” Adams mentioned, pointing to 1 candidate who efficiently petitioned for a recount (and raised the cash to pay for it), solely to file a brand new grievance after the recount confirmed the unique outcomes. “They love making these reasonable-sounding arguments after which they get referred to as on it and so they present their true colours.”

In an interview with FiveThirtyEight, Rhonda Palazzo, one of many Kentucky candidates who sought a recount (although in a legitimately slim race, with a distinction of simply 58 votes), mentioned she wasn’t making any accusations of fraud, but additionally referenced the extensively debunked conspiracy concept documentary “2000 Mules,” which claims {that a} community of “mules” stuffed poll bins across the nation in 2020, utilizing specious proof. 

However many election deniers, like Lake, are profitable their elections, which presents them with extra of a conundrum. Once you’ve spent months complaining that the election system is rigged, what do you say while you win? For some candidates, the answer is to go mum. Doug Mastriano, the Republican nominee for governor in Pennsylvania, had an extended historical past of parroting Trump’s claims of a stolen election, proper up till he gained his major. When he declared victory on election night time, he had nothing to say in regards to the rigged election system. And he’s not alone — many Republican nominees have been all too completely happy to simply accept the outcomes of their very own races after spending months casting doubts on the 2020 election.

Some raised complaints of fraud even after they’d gained. After Jim Marchant, the Republican nominee for secretary of state in Nevada, gained his race, he mentioned he was “probably not assured within the consequence.”

“Fraud is a harsh phrase, however there may have been anomalies — malicious or unintentional — based mostly on what I’ve heard,” Marchant advised the Las Vegas Evaluation-Journal, however added that he nonetheless accepted his victory. “What am I speculated to do, not win?” 

These candidates are all singing completely different verses of the identical music, a option to proceed to sow doubt within the election system whereas benefiting from the help of voters who imagine in such claims. And given the variety of election deniers who’ve gained their primaries up to now, it’s possible we’ll hear an encore come November.
